GARFIELD-AF Mortality Risk Model: Explanation and Clinical Context The GARFIELD-AF Mortality Risk Model is a validated predictive tool derived from the Global Anticoagulant Registry in the FIELD-Atrial Fibrillation (GARFIELD-AF) registry. It estimates the 1-year all-cause mortality risk in patients with newly diagnosed atrial fibrillation based on age, sex, comorbidities (heart failure, vascular disease, diabetes, prior stroke/TIA), smoking status, and renal function. This model helps clinicians identify high-risk patients who may benefit from closer monitoring, early interventions, and optimized anticoagulation therapy.
